In answer to your first question, I think that Jesus is in fact the Light of the world, both now and forever. In John 8:12 it Jesus say " I am the light of the world, whoever follows me will never walk in darkness but in the light." So we can see that we will never walk in darkness but in the light. The word never is a huge word with a lot of meaning. HE says never becuase he means NEVER, therefor Jesus is always the light, becuase he is what keeps us from darkness. If he were to cease to be that Light we woudl find ourselves surrounded in darkness, and this can never happen. Does that answer your question? I am not sure if I explained that very well. The scriptures also say in Mathew, that as Christians we are to be the Light of the world, a city on a hill. WE are to show the love of God, and live as he did. So in a sense Both God and Christians are the Light. |
